Can you give our readers an introduction to your business? Maybe you can share a bit about what you do and what sets you apart from others?
Against All Odds Professional Counseling Services was founded in Nov 2017 and is a private mental health practice serving clients in Tennessee.
I believe in giving the highest quality care based on Christian principles to help people feel empowered, encouraged, and equipped with practical strategies for gaining new perspectives to live freely. The vision is to offer transformational services to working professionals including entrepreneurs, college students, and married couples so that they can disrupt unhealthy cycles and patterns, replace unhealthy coping and narratives with healthier ones, and rise above all circumstances despite the odds against them. I am called to partner with people (professionals, executives, Christians, young adults, adults, couples) through God’s power to help move them toward healing and freedom. I treat the whole person by way of counseling for the mind, christ centered counseling for the spirit, help people travel more, better for less which is helpful for the total person as well as help people through natural products to heal internally and externally. One of the things that sets this practice apart is the values:
FISK-Q
• Faith
• Integrity
• Service
• Kindness
• Quality
It has not been easy – but I am thankful to be in position to serve. I continue to seek consultation, training to help me be competent and I continue to rely on my faith to get me through. I am very proud of being a clinician and to serve people. I am constantly learning that I have to be flexible and be willing to change and pivot. I am also learning that I cannot work in silo and although I love working from home and have since March 2020- it is important to have a community or access to community.
I am learning that business is not about me and the value of consultations to determine best fit for clients- understanding that I cannot serve everyone nor am I supposed to.
I am learning and this is still difficult that there is a time to rest my body, rest my mind because in business your mind is always on- it’s good to unplug and have fun! It’s important to be refreshed and rest on God’s promises and in prayer and it’s also good to connect with others and disconnect. I love to travel and am so thankful that I am part of an amazing travel club that allows me to travel better for less.
I am constantly learning the importance of routines, structure and prioritizing tasks- even making space to work on my physical health, my own mental health and ensuring that I stay anchored in my faith- after all how can I show up to others if I’m not my best.
I recognize that I will never arrive but will constantly learn.
